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5556677329 28720022 63087454803 34 923378
99592 104177 7834221897
99592 104177 7834221897
30510947 566985062 2241
All about undefined
Interested in learning more?
99592 104177 7834221897
30510947 566985062 2241
See more
08 84925946 8694080957
999 51036838 53843422735 41655958
See more
8156789754 7299322778 7630646936
18 756799694 46363
See more